当表具有DENY INSERT时,为什么表会更新带触发器

时间:2012-07-03 10:03:41

标签: sql sql-server database triggers

我有一个记录表tbRecords,它还有一个审计表tbRecordsAudit

审计表对于特定AD组具有DENY INSERT,并且具有用于插入审计表的触发器。

我的问题是,尽管审计表上有DENY INSERT,但仍会从触发器中插入记录。触发器也不使用`EXECUTE AS命令。

我没有写这个,所做的是复制数据库中审计表的现有设置。似乎没有人理解为什么插入工作在审计表上。

我知道存储过程中的INSERT可以取代DENY INSERT,是否与触发器相同?

0 个答案:

没有答案